Position Summary

Brown Advisory is seeking a proactive, resourceful, and versatile individual to serve as a Portfolio Analyst (PA) for Brown Advisory's Outsourced Chief Investment Officer (OCIO) team. The ideal candidate is a motivated individual who is able to help drive change and solve complex challenges by utilizing data and their analytical capabilities. Specific functional expectations are to help support ongoing client reporting needs, ensure accurate and timely portfolio updates, maintain proprietary databases to support investment decision making, among other responsibilities. The role will be dynamic and day-to-day responsibilities will evolve commensurate with experience, interests, and client needs.

Essential Functions/Responsibilities:
  • Generate monthly, quarterly, and ad-hoc reports for our OCIO relationships
  • Produce custom analytics for reporting on a regular or ad-hoc basis
  • Develop, communicate, and/or expound on reports and analysis for internal and external stakeholders
  • Troubleshoot any reporting or operational process errors; develop close working relationships across teams to help propose and implement solutions
  • Manage projects to create or improve reporting content and/or advance strategic business goals
  • Analyze and interpret relevant investment data, including portfolio positions, transactions, and performance
  • Support clients through their various events (i.e. an audit) and ensure accurate information is provided to 3rd party vendors
  • Build rapport across the firm's operational teams and collaborate to solve challenges
Minimum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Economics, Business Administration, Accounting or related subject
  • 2-5 years of investment or reporting experience
  • Superior anal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Curiosity of capital markets and an intention to pursue Chartered Financial Analyst designation
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Strong work ethic
  • Ability to establish priorities and manage multiple workstreams
  • Flexibility and the willingness to adapt to rapidly changing priorities
  • Professional maturity, keen judgement, and the ability to handle confidential information with discretion
  • Strong Microsoft Excel (VBA is a plus) and PowerPoint skills
  • Knowledge of FactSet/Tableau/Advent/Bloomberg is an advantage
  • Ability to work in an office location


Salary: $75-$100k. Commensurate with experience and location. Does not include bonus or long term incentive eligibility (if applicable).
